Faulty accelerator/RAM maybe?

Try filling the RAM disk with files from the hard disk until full and then remove the entire contents- does the Amiga crash?

Boot the Amiga from the Workbench disk and monitor it- do you still get crashes?

A quick easy test is to totally fill then totally purge the RAM disk- this will test the integrity of the memory and a lot of the accelerator functions.

If you get that test out of the way, you can start looking in other areas.

Switch off the computer for 10 mins. Cold Boot for your Workbench floppy disk and not your hard disk- this will boot a 'clean' environment.

Does the accelerator crash- if so it is not software.
